The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 31733, Chula, Georgia is 60 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
94.21 percent of the population in 31733 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 89.67 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 1.03 percent of the residents in 31733 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.30 members with about 2.32 cars available per household.
An estimate of 87.60 percent of the residents in 31733 has some form of health insurance. 24.79 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 75.62 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 31733 would have to travel an average of 16.53 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Dorminy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 31733, Chula, Georgia.

As of , an estimate of 1,218 residents live in 31733 with a median age of 38.8 years. 31.86 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 20.94 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 41.47 percent of the residents in 31733 is currently married, and 9.56 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 31733 is $6,916.67.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 31733 is approximately $767. The median household spends about 11.09 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that affects the way the body processes blood sugar (glucose). It can lead to serious health complications if not managed properly. Access to healthcare services is crucial for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es to receive regular check-ups, medication management, and lifestyle counseling.

When considering the financial cost of missing a healthcare provider's appointment for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es, it's important to recognize the potential consequences. Missing appointments can lead to uncontrolled blood sugar levels, which increases the risk of developing complications such as heart disease, kidney damage, and nerve damage. Additionally, missed appointments may result in medication mismanagement and missed opportunities for early intervention.
